Louisiana State University Gradu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time graduate tuition at Louisiana State University was $1,196 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$546 per credit hour. Information about average full-time graduate student t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$9,132$9,132
Fees$3,903$20,838

During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 3 doctor’s degrees in subject specific ed hand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 33.3% of the subject specific ed students who took home a doctor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 65.5%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 33.3% of subject specific ed doctor’s degree recipients at Louisiana State University in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 26%.
